I have heard from a number in BA that Airbus told them that they would have to stop when Air France did; BA fought tooth and nail to be allowed to fly on to 24 October. They would like to have flown through 2004, but Airbus would not let them. The original pre-Re-life date of 2007 went out the window.

Airbus have killed Concorde, not BA. The whole thing is a mighty stich-up between Air France (who lost the bottle) and Airbus (we can't let the British have exclusivity).

It is worth remembering, that if BA had not taken over the entire Concorde operation in 1984, commercial supersonic flight would have ended then. Not 19 years later. BA should be praised for showing that commercial supersonic flight can be viable.
